The Business
Tailors’ Union is a downtown speakeasy. From the outside it looks like a tailor’s shop, but that’s just a front for the elegant two-story bar behind the doors.The ground floor features a huge bar, booths, and lounge seating. There are strong tailor-themed cocktails (The Half Slip, High & Tight, In Stitches, and Lost Stiletto) and delicious eats like wagyu sliders, duck tacos, crab cakes and Parmesan truffle fries. Downstairs is The Pocket, and it’s members only with an annual fee. It has a dark, cozy bar, a cigar lounge, and, on Fridays, live music.
